About us
Royal Surrey NHS Foundation Trust is a friendly, supportive, busy but welcoming acute and community Trust that is ambitious about developing our services and your career.
Our compassionate, caring and friendly colleagues make up our Royal Surrey family and are at the heart of what we do. We all have a passion for learning, continuous improvement and excelling together through innovation, research and development. There are over 4,500 members of our Royal Surrey family.
We are clinically led and provide joined up care by bridging the gap between hospital and community services alongside regional specialist cancer care. Our main acute hospital site is in Guildford with community hospital sites at Milford, Haslemere and Cranleigh. We provide adult community health services in the community and homes across Guildford and Waverley.
We have received an overall Good rating from the CQC with Medical care (including older peoples care), End of Life Care and Maternity services being deemed Outstanding by the CQC. We are investing in our colleagues through our health and wellbeing programme and a commitment to supporting professional development as well as investing more than £45 million in our physical environment and new equipment in the next few years.

Job description
Job responsibilities
To cover administrative
and secretarial responsibilities for the department.
To
provide a full range of medical secretarial assistance to consultants and their
team. Manage own workload, demonstrate efficient organisation and oversee the
smooth effective operation of the office.
To work autonomously within a team, providing full organisational
support to the consultants practice and their team. To ensure procedures and working practices
are in place so that the speciality and Trust can deliver a service that meets
the standards and targets that have been set. To provide a considerate, patient focussed
service in all dealings with patients and with staff around the hospital and
throughout the whole system.

Person Specification
Experience
Essential
- Working knowledge of a range of software packages e.g. Microsoft Word, Excel, Access and PowerPoint, and locally used data bases e.g. Telepath and SweetP (*).
- Excellent verbal communication and interpersonal skills.
-
- Excellent telephone manner.
- Knowledge of basic anatomy and physiology.
- Broad knowledge of medical terminology.
-
- Detailed knowledge of patient pathways and advanced medical terminology in own area of work (*).
-
- Knowledge of NHS priorities and understanding of the guidelines and targets in own area of work (*).
- Excellent spelling and grammar.
- Experience of working in busy environment.
-
- Experience of dealing with the general public.
- Experience in a medical environment as a medical secretary.
- Experience of mentoring, training or supervising others.
-
- Awareness and understanding of NHS issues.
-
- Experience in using patient administration systems.
- Experience of working in a large complex organisation and a multidisciplinary environment.
Qualifications
Essential
- Good general standard of education to GCSE level or equivalent including English.
- RSA II or equivalent in word processing/audio typing RSA III, Medical secretarial qualification (BSMS Certificate) or equivalent.
